Q: What are LiteDOTs?
A: They are surface mount LED tail lights
that incorprate LED backup and side marker lights.

Using the included self tapping bolt, thread it in two of the existing holes (the upper two holes) with a socket and ratchet. Using a fair amount of force with both hands on the ratchet, thread the new bolt in to the holes to resize the bolt home from metric threads to 1/4 SAE threads.
Once new threads have been cut, take the LiteDOT mounting botls and fully thread them in to the holes to ensure the threads are ready to accept the new bolts. if you encoutner any resistance, rethread with the self taping bolt to clean up the threads.

Remove the lens and the old school fixture
by
removing the three bolts holding it on place
Gently pull the wire harness up through the hole. This proved
to be a major challenge because there was some foam tape wrapped
around the plug. The charcoal canister is located behind the
right tail light, which makes for only about 3/4 - 1" of
clearance between it and the tub.
To get this far, I temporarily resecured the tail light and
pulled the harness out through the bottom and removed the
foam tape from around the plug. Next I removed the OEM light
and was able to getthe plug to pull through the gap between
the tub and charcoal canister and then out the hole.

Next step is to strip the wires and place
the
solder shrink splices on the wires.
Slide the shrink splices over the wire first. Use a method of splicing commonly referred to as an "audio
twist" (twist the ends together to perfom
a straight splice).
Heat up the shrink splice up with a heatgun until the solder completely flows through
the splice and the tubing melts and seals up at each end.

Reconnect the plug and feed the wire down
through the hole.
I used a piece of electrical tape to seal off the unused
upper mounting hole for the OEM tail lights, which isn't use
for the LiteDOTs
The kit includes a self tapping SAE
bolt used to reform the threaded holes.
Use a socket and ratchet to thread the bolt in to the lower
two holes. Apply plenty of pressure to ensure the bolt bites
in and starts cutting new threads, otherwise you will simply
strip out the hole.
When threading it in, it will reform the threads to accept
the SAE threaded bolts, which are ever so slighty larger than
the metric bolts of the OEM tail lights.
Prior to mounting the LiteDOTs, take the mounting screws
and thread them in to the holes to ensure they thread in OK.

DONE!
Don't forget to attach the reflective tape included with
the kit to the back of the Jeep. Most people attach it to
the rear lower corner of the tub, wrapping it around the corner.
Some sort of reflective material is
required in the US to meet FMVSS 108
What is FMVSS 108? It's the Federal Motor Vehicle Safety
Standard that outlines lighting and reflective requirements
for vehicles and trailers.
Canada has a similar regulation.
